Mrs. Renz's 4th Grade Class  Redmond, Oregon

 

Student Rainforest Projects

The letter from Mrs. Renz arrived.  In it, students were introduced to the project.  Student teams were asked to choose one of the 14 project choices to conduct an inquiry research project on.  See the letter explaining choices.  They will use the JASON web site, our rainforest web page, library books and magazines to collect information.  As part of the imaginary storyline, students learned they had to be vaccinated!

Student teams will create a JASON XV Poster Session which they will take and display at OMSI, our local PIN site as they watch the live broadcast from the rainforest of Panama.  Here are the finished posters.
